Q: Is 664,852 a Prime Number?
A: No, 664,852 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 664852 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 347 479 694 958 1,388 1,916 166,213 332,426 and 664,852, with no remainder.
Since 664,852 cannot be divided by just 1 and 664,852, it is not a prime number.
